We don't have discussed of rules of the game.
It's seems important.
I have played several pebm on this age of discovery scenario, and special rules must be added i think.

- The war in the starting european territories.
I think must be forbiden (if all are ok). Because if you loose your capital, it can be moved to one of the colony... and then it's really easy to bring back treasures to that new capital (no sea transport of that treasure... no danger to be captured).

SO capital must not change...


- The exploitation of the ressources.
The most important rule !!!
Because you can built 6 city arround 1 unique ressource, and then built 6 city improvement that will generate treasures...
With one ressource, you can have 6 city exploiting and producing....

Shema : 0 : ressource, T town
XTXTX
XXXXX
TX0XT
XXXXX
XTXTX

I think a such method is quite ingenious, but not fair... So i propose to fobid it.
The interest of the game is to find max of ressource, not to over exploit 1 or 2 of them.

- the naval bridges
this is possible to make 1 unit to cross the map form part to part, if naval transport are well placed...
We have to decide if it is allowed or not.
For this, i think we can allow it because its hard to have enough naval transport to do big bridges. And moreover, its hard to protect that bridge.... so, as there are corsair vessels, we can easyly cut the brige.


So, i think we can discus and set the rules ... the soonner is better.
